Durham Fell Runners, Steve Lumb and Stuart Ferguson travelled to Strathcarron in north west Scotland and competed in the two day Lowe Alpine Mountain Marathon.

The two runners were hampered by strong winds, rain and even snow on Saturday and heavy drizzle combined with low cloud on Sunday. They completed the very demanding Elite course in 15 hours and 36 minutes over the two days, running more than 60km with 4000m of ascent; finishing in eighth place.

The club holds weekly training sessions in Hamsterly Forest on Thursday evenings, meeting between 6.45pm and 7pm at the visitor centre. These sessions are developed in conjunction with the only fell running coach in the North-East. The sessions are suitable for all abilities.
